How KeyRD works
Continuity work, with the boundary visible.
KeyRD is designed to draw on the records around ongoing MNT, identify a small set of between-visit moments worth review, and propose the smallest appropriate next step.
What it draws on.
Depending on platform access: the documented nutrition intervention or ADIME note, appointment status, cancellations and no-shows, patient messages, questionnaires, food logs, and other practice records that are actually available. Each proposed decision should identify its source and what is still unknown.
What reaches the RDN.
Exceptions, not every patient. A booked visit can mean ABSTAIN. A missing fact can mean ASK RDN. A question clearly covered by the documented intervention can produce a SUPPORT draft for review. An expired intervention, medication decision, concerning symptom, or other boundary can RETURN CONTROL.
Prior silence never increases KeyRD’s authority to contact a patient. No reply is uncertainty, not permission to intensify outreach.
Where you see it.
The current evaluation uses a bounded review workflow rather than pretending a finished Healthie or Practice Better placement already exists. Platform-native placement and which staff roles may act on which items remain product requirements to validate with practices.
Four responses, one vocabulary.
SUPPORT proposes help within what the RDN documented. ASK RDN returns a missing fact or judgment to the RDN. ABSTAIN avoids an unnecessary next step. RETURN CONTROL stops when the next step exceeds the intervention or belongs elsewhere.
In shadow mode, these are proposals for RDN review. Nothing is automatically sent to patients.
Visit limits are context, not instructions.
If a patient reaches an MNT visit limit, KeyRD should surface that constraint—not infer coverage or manufacture an outreach opportunity. The practice may need benefits verification, scheduling, a self-pay discussion, pause, discharge, or no action.
